=== Problem to solve
In the current Timeline, to scrutinize the contents of every edit, users must open the diffs in a new tab. This makes using the Timeline a multiple-tab tool, which may decrease productivity.
----
=== Acceptance criteria
* When a user clicks on an edit box the diff container should open, which includes:
** A fixed header
*** "Revision as of TIMESTAMP" linked to the revision, above each revision column
*** "by USERNAME" linked to the userpage, above each revision column
*** A close button in the top right corner. When clicked, the diff container should close.
** A two-column wikitext diff with the same styling as it does on standard desktop Wikimedia diff pages ([[https://en.wikipedia.org/w/index.php?title=Typhoon_%28American_band%29&type=revision&diff=805661470&oldid=796554201|example]])
*** Line numbers
*** Color coding and highlighting
*** + and - symbols
*** The diff should have a maximum height of 500 pixels and should scroll within if needed
* Multiple diffs should be able to be opened on the same page.

===Notes
There should probably be an `onClick()` handler on the revision card. When clicked, it will dispatch an action to go get the diff (if it doesn't already exist). The diff should //probably// be stored within the revision object. If this needs a loading indicator, you would probably have to add some sort of `loading` flag on //each// revision. It might not need a full-blown loading indicator, it could be something subtle... like the hover color sticks around or something like that.
